  5. The band was formed in Tennessee in 2005, consisting of members Jason Barton, Chris Lockwood, and Collin Stoddard. The name '33Miles' was derived from the 33 years it is believed Christ spent on Earth. The band's eponymous debut album was released in 2007.

  7. 33Miles is the self-titled debut studio album from Christian rock band 33Miles. It was released on April 10, 2007 on INO Records . Track listing. A bonus disc was available for anyone who bought the album in advance. Chart positions. The album reached No. 16 on the Top Christian Albums chart, and No. 8 on the Top Heatseekers chart.
